Output e52889d43533c4efd45d903359708481dd533a4e2c3d3d39febd0ef515741fee:6

value
301520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f5a7da349eda685735be7c6bf120b7e4dfb6a7 OP_EQUAL
address
3QkYVLhTn9SGLTNp4rY4zGAUXEefuUWn1w
transaction
e52889d43533c4efd45d903359708481dd533a4e2c3d3d39febd0ef515741fee
spent
true